Closing entries, also known as closing journal entries, are the final steps taken at the end of an accounting period to transfer the balances of temporary accounts to permanent accounts. Temporary accounts include revenue, expense, and dividend accounts, while permanent accounts consist of asset, li...

Understanding Closing Entries The purpose of the closing entry is to reset temporaryaccount balancesto zero on thegeneral ledger, the record-keeping system for a company's financial data. Temporary accounts are used to record accounting activity during a specific period. All revenue and expense accou...
